Funding cuts still left the social care procedure in crisis even ahead of COVID

Sky News analysis reveals that the social treatment sector was straining from a scarcity of funding and a growing need to have prolonged just before the pandemic disclosed a technique in disaster.

A lot more than fifty percent of regional authorities skilled a drop in per human being spending in the 10 years to 2020, in accordance to knowledge from NHS Digital.

The quantities are even starker in London, the place just about nine in 10 neighborhood authorities seasoned a funding slash.

How have we done the calculations?

We have decided on to adjust social care paying out for inflation and inhabitants advancement as per human being spending in today’s prices will allow a much more precise comparison more than time.

Social treatment staff give own care and defense to susceptible persons of all ages with disabilities and sicknesses.

But some say that expending cuts have intended their work have shifted from furnishing high quality of existence to just keeping individuals alive.

And the crisis in funding comes at a time when want and expense have hardly ever been so large.

Because 2016, the amount of new requests for aid in England have increased 5.6% and fees have long gone up by extra than a quarter.

Spots with high levels of deprivation have been most afflicted.

Genuine for each individual spending fell 6.8% on average for the most deprived fifth of councils, in comparison to a 2.1% rise for the the very least deprived 20%.

Some carers perform two jobs to fork out the charges

The crunch in funding has experienced a detrimental affect on employees and customers.

Viviane Ferreira De Melo has been a care employee in Lewisham because the start out of the pandemic.

“Our occupation is pretty demanding and we cannot present a superior high-quality of care because we have to cover shifts for the reason that of a deficiency of staff,” she says.

Viviane Ferreira De Melo is a care worker in Lewisham
Picture:
Viviane Ferreira De Melo is a treatment employee in Lewisham

Viviane says she typically arrives early and does unpaid function for her customers to give them the care they need.

“To depart them with a smile and know that I’ve performed anything I can for them is what will make me occur out just about every working day,” she suggests. “If it was not so satisfying, I wouldn’t be in this article any more.”

To give this treatment she has to refuse some customers and works a second task as a cleaner to pay out her bills each and every month.

“If items continue as they are, I really don’t know if I can continue to be working as a carer,” she suggests. “It is really a career I definitely delight in but I have to pay my payments, I have a household to support.”

Care personnel are not paid for vacation time involving shoppers, meaning that they are often compensated for significantly less than six hrs of perform when they do an 8-hour shift.

As a end result, even councils like Lewisham that pay back the London Living wage are unable to are unable to obtain care employees, in particular when there are lots of other employment accessible.

In April, low unemployment pushed the proportion of unfilled roles in treatment to 10.3%, the best fee in a decade.

Carers struggle to offer people with quality of lifetime

Tom Brown, Lewisham council’s govt director for local community companies, claims funding cuts and staff shortages have necessitated a shift from “providing people excellent of lifestyle to just supporting them survive”.

“A 10 years ago, we were being equipped to be revolutionary, to check out and get forward of the curve and really make a variance to people’s life,” he says.

“The issues that we have to do carry on but we’ve had to halt carrying out matters that improve people’s life.”

London councils like Lewisham bought significantly less assist for grownup social care all through the pandemic. The North East been given all around 80% a lot more in grants for every human being than London.

pandemic support

But the excess assist was nevertheless essential. Brown says that COVID will have a “very prolonged tail” and the finish of this extra help will depart “a enormous gap” in grownup social treatment budgets.

“The pressures on councils as the COVID-particular funding finishes are already showing,” he claims.

“There will be an enormous influence from the NHS discharging people today as they catch up with their COVID backlog.”

He states that without having additional funding, the NHS restoration “will fall short” and councils will be forced to change even far more of their restricted sources to “propping up” the treatment sector.

Most councils have presently experienced to lessen spending in other places to support grownup social care.

All but 1 council in our examination now spends a larger share of their income on these solutions than they did a 10 years back.

ASC bar %

Irrespective of this, grownup social care products and services are underfunded and prices are growing speedier than inflation as councils try out to prop up suppliers.

Simon Bottery, senior fellow at feel tank The King’s Fund, suggests that numerous vendors have struggled to keep in organization due to the fact of soaring labour expenses, in component driven by the minimal wage. He claims that using the services of employees stays the “solitary largest challenge” for the sector.

“The grind to come across sufficient team feels mind-boggling at the instant and there is certainly no real close in sight,” he suggests.

What is remaining performed to address the crisis in care?

The govt lately released new laws to reform social care. The Health and Care Act introduces a life time cap on the sum folks will shell out in the direction of their care and minimizes the rate of care for folks who self-fund.

This will support a lot of people today currently outside the public social treatment system.

A government spokesperson advised Sky News that “the funding created readily available to councils for social treatment has increased by around £1 billion on a yearly basis more than the very last 3 several years.”

They extra that the govt is “offering file funding for adult social care reform by the Health and Social Care Levy, which will guarantee we can tackle Covid backlogs, finish spiralling social treatment expenditures, and give a limit to the value of care for anyone in the adult social treatment program for the initially time.”

Some argue the reforms do not deal with the pressing workforce troubles and will improve the strain on nearby authorities by pushing up prices and demand from customers for their services.

Bottery suggests the reforms are “authentic positives”, but also a problem for community authorities.

“Neighborhood authorities truly feel overwhelmed,” he says. “There is added funds to help these changes, but area authorities and suppliers say it just isn’t sufficient.”
